What's The Definition Of Caregiver?
caregiver
countable noun: A caregiver is someone who is responsible for looking after another person, for example, a person who has a disability, or is ill or very young. caregiver in American English a person who takes care of someone requiring close attention, as a young child or an invalid noun: a person who cares for someone who is sick or disabled caregiver in British English noun: a person who has accepted responsibility for looking after a vulnerable neighbour or relative |
